Question:
Which is your best seal for a 7000 pound axle 16 in wheel I need 4
asked by: Mike B
0
Expert Reply:
There are two common grease seals used on 7,000 lbs axles, part # GS-2250DL which has a 2.250" inner diameter and part # GS-2125DL which has a 2.125" inner diameter. The former is more common and used on newer trailers. They are both double lip seals which hold grease in better.
